The Sales Representative builds strong relationships with customers and authorized dealers, provides product support and training, and collaborates with internal teams to deliver solutions that meet customer needs. The role is responsible for achieving regional sales, profitability, customer satisfaction, and collection targets while managing promotional activities, tenders, forecasts, and customer engagement initiatives.
Essential duties and responsibilities
Establishes and assures excellent business relations with the customers and authorized dealers in the region.
Visits customers in frequent basis to maintain good relation live, assist healthcare professionals in the OR for appropriate product use.
Gains confidence and respect of the customer in the name of Baxter Healthcare.
Coordinates and initiates company resources to produce ideal solutions to meet customer needs.
Acts and controls all kind of promotional activities in the region in coordination with Business Unit Manager.
Realizes the targets for his/her region on: Customer Satisfaction, Sales, DSO, profitability.
Participates in tenders in his/her region.
Prepares and submits regular sales activity, sales and forecast reports to Business Unit Manager.
Makes customer activities and training arrangements in coordination with other sales representatives in the region.
Conducts the authorized dealer in the region for the sales and marketing activities and for Customer visits.
Preferred location: Antalya with regular travel required across the assigned territory, including Isparta, Burdur, Afyon, Konya, and Kayseri.
Qualifications
Bachelor’s Degree in a scientific field or Clinical Support certificate required.
Minimum 4 years of sales experience in related field.
Communicative level of English is preferred.
Mastery of Microsoft Office (Outlook, Word, PowerPoint & Excel).
Strong sales, negotiation, and business acumen, with the ability to develop in-depth product and market knowledge and maintain a professional customer-focused approach.
Excellent communication and relationship-building skills, with the confidence and interpersonal abilities to effectively engage healthcare professionals, customers, and business partners.
Highly motivated and results-driven, with strong organizational and time-management skills, and the ability to work independently as well as collaboratively to achieve targets.
No military obligation for male candidates.
Candidates should have a driving license with two years of driving experience.
Certified by MOH separately for “Clinical Support” and “Sales & Promotion”.
